STATEMENT of the NET REVENUE, arising from CUSTOMS RECEIPTS and the
APPROPRIATION thereof, for the Quarter ended 30th September, 1854.
| Net Revenue. | Proportion of One-Third retained by Sub-Treasurer. | Proportion of Two-Thirds paid to Provincial Treasurer. | TOTAL. |
|---|---|---|---|
| £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. |
| 2,737 5 5 | 922 8 3 | 1,814 17 2 | 2,737 5 5 |
EDWARD HUGH ENES BLACKMORE,
Sub-Treasurer.
Sub-Treasury, Nelson.
October 25, 1854.
ABSTRACT GAOL RETURN for the Quarter ended 30th September, 1854.
| Received into Gaol during the Quarter. | For Debt. | For Misdemeanor. | For Felony. | For Safe Custody as Lunatic. | For Offences against Naval or Military Discipline. | Total. | In Gaol at Commence-ment of the Quarter. | Discharged from Gaol since. | In Gaol at Close of the Quarter. |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Soldiers |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- |
| Sailors | - | 1 | 20 | - | - | - | 21 | 5 | 11 | 16 |
| Civilians | - | 1 | - | 2 | - | - | 3 | 2 | 1 | 3 |
| Maories |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| - |
| 2 | 20 | 2 | - | - | 24 | 7 | 12 | 19 |
B. WALMSLEY,
Sheriff.
Sheriff's Office, Nelson,
Oct. 1, 1854.
ABSTRACT of RECEIPTS and EXPENDITURE of the LAND DEPARTMENT of the
Province of NELSON, for the Quarter ended the 30th September, 1854.
| RECEIPTS. | EXPENDITURE. |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| |||
| Sales of Crown Lands (Cash Proceeds) | 7,627 0 6 | Salaries | 227 12 0 | ||
| Depasturage Licenses | 22 0 0 | Contingencies | 100 6 10 | 327 18 10 | |
| Depasturage Fees | 4 3 10 | ||||
| Timber Licenses | 2 10 0 | New Zealand Company's One-fourth | 1,912 5 1 | ||
| Assisted Passages repaid | 34 0 0 | Payments to Provincial Treasury | 5,513 16 8 | ||
| Fees on Crown Grants | 105 0 0 | Do. to General Government | 40 13 9 | ||
| TOTAL RECEIPTS . . £ | 7,794 14 4 | TOTAL EXPENDITURE . . £ | 7,794 14 4 | ||
| Balance from previous Quarter | 1,872 0 0 | Balance carried to next Quarter | 1,872 0 0 | ||
| £ 9,666 14 4 | £ | 9,666 14 4 |
M. RICHMOND,
Commissioner of Crown Lands.
Land Office, Nelson,
6 October, 1854.
